Throughout the season, https://www.tottenhamhotspur.com target=_blank rel=noopener>Tottenham has not been distinguished by any stability, and there is no progress in the team's play, rather, on the contrary, there is a decline. However, it is less common to see bright matches performed by the Londoners, even a powerful attack increasingly fails, which could be observed, for example, in the recent home match in the Premier League against Nottingham Forest (0:1).
After a tough win in the League Cup over Manchester United (4:3), Ange Postegoclu's men played four matches in the Premier League, in which they scored only one point thanks to a peaceful outcome with Wolverhampton (2:2). In the last round, a 1:2 home defeat was recorded against Newcastle. Spurs' defense regularly fails, only in one of the five previous matches did they concede less than two goals. As a result, in the standings after 20 rounds, Tottenham occupies a modest 12th place with 24 points. It should be noted that home walls have not helped the team much this season, as they have scored only 14 points in 11 matches in the Premier League on their home field.
In the League Cup, in addition to the quarter-final victory over Manchester United, they also managed to beat Coventry City and Manchester City with the same score of 2:1. It should be noted that the last time Tottenham reached the League Cup final was in 2021, but then lost in the decisive match to Manchester City with a score of 0:1.

Liverpool have won the League Cup in two of the last three editions, and, interestingly, they beat Chelsea in the finals twice. It is clear that the Merseysiders are betting on winning another trophy this season. The Liverpool team has three rounds under their belt. They started with a crushing 5:1 victory over West Ham. They followed this with more difficult matches against Brighton (3:2) and Southampton (2:1). It should be noted that far from the main squad was involved in the game against the Saints.
In the Premier League, Arne Sloth's men failed to beat Manchester United (2:2) in the previous round. However, this failure did not have a significant impact on the tournament position. After 20 rounds, Liverpool confidently holds the first line with a gap of six points from Arsenal and Nottingham Forest, and there is still a game in hand.
Liverpool's opponents in the first game of the semi-final are the familiar Tottenham. On December 22, in a face-to-face meeting within the Premier League, the Merseysiders completely dominated the Londoners' penalty area, scoring six goals, although they could have scored more (6:3). In general, in the five previous face-to-face confrontations, the Liverpool team won four victories, and consistently scored at least two goals.
